Warning Signs You Need Residential Water Extraction
Catching water damage early can save you thousands in repairs. Be on the lookout for these warning signs, and don’t hesitate to call our team for help.
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away
Strong, unpleasant odors can show the presence of mold and mildew, which can spread quickly and cause serious health issues. If you notice a persistent musty smell in your home, don’t wait to address it.
Water Stains on the Ceiling or Walls
Water stains can be a sign of a leak or water damage, which can cause structural issues and lead to costly repairs. If you notice water stains, call our team to assess the damage.
Warped or Buckled Flooring
Warped or buckled flooring can show water damage, which can cause further issues if left untreated. If you notice any signs of water damage on your flooring, don’t delay in getting it fixed.
Peeling Paint or Wallpaper
Peeling paint or wallpaper can show moisture issues, which can lead to further damage if left untreated. If you notice any signs of peeling paint or wallpaper, call our team to assess the damage.
Excessive Condensation
Excessive condensation can show a moisture issue, which can cause mold and mildew growth. If you notice excessive condensation on windows or walls, call our team to address the issue.
Unusual Sounds or Leaks
Unusual sounds or leaks can show a water issue, which can cause further damage if left untreated. If you notice any signs of unusual sounds or leaks, don’t delay in getting it fixed.
Residential Water Extraction vs. DIY: When To Call a Professional
| Situation | DIY? | Call a Pro? | Why |
|---|---|---|---|
| Small leak in a bathroom or kitchen | Yes | No | You can likely fix the leak and dry the area yourself. |
| Large flood in a basement or crawlspace | No | Yes | You’ll need specialized equipment and expertise to extract the water and dry the area. |
| Water damage to a single room or area | Maybe | Yes | You may be able to dry the area yourself, but a professional can ensure the job is done correctly and thoroughly. |
| Water damage to multiple rooms or areas | No | Yes | You’ll need a professional to assess the damage and develop a plan to dry and repair the affected areas. |
| Mold or mildew growth | No | Yes | You’ll need a professional to safely and effectively remove the mold and mildew. |
| Highly contaminated water (e.g. Sewage, floodwater) | No | Yes | You’ll need a professional to safely and effectively extract and treat the contaminated water. |

Residential Water Extraction Cost In Camp Pendleton North, CA
The cost of residential water extraction can vary depending on the severity and size of the affected area, as well as local conditions. Our team provides free estimates and works with your insurance company to ensure a smooth claims process. Don’t wait to get your home back to normal – call us today for a free estimate.
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Water Extraction | $500 – $2,500 | Size of affected area, severity of damage, and local conditions |
| Drying and Dehumidification | $1,000 – $5,000 | Size of affected area, type of drying equipment needed, and duration of drying process |
| Mold Remediation | $1,500 – $10,000 | Size of affected area, type of mold, and extent of remediation needed |
| Contents Restoration | $1,000 – $5,000 | Value of damaged contents, type of restoration needed, and complexity of the job |
| Structural Drying | $2,000 – $10,000 | Size of affected area, type of structural drying equipment needed, and duration of drying process |
| Debris Removal | $500 – $2,000 | Size of debris, type of debris, and complexity of the job |
